闪电网络是什么?

      在币圈,我们常常听到闪电网络的概念,闪电网络到底是什么?是一种网络结构还是一种什么技术?和比特币到底有什么关系?本文我们就一起来扒一扒这个闪电网络吧。

闪电网络是什么?_第1张图片

  比特币的区块链机制自身提供了很好的可信保障,但是很慢,全网每秒 7 笔的交易速度,远低于传统的金融交易系统;而且等待 6 个块的可信确认导致约 1 个小时的最终确认时间。

  而闪电网络的思路则十分简单,把频繁的小额的交易转移到比特币主链外的网络进行,不需要在比特币主网上做共识确认,从而提高交易的效率和整个比特币网络的性能。

  闪电网络支持两个没有建立支付通道的账户之间交易,只要这两个账户可以通过和其他账户之间建立的支付通道连接起来。

  所以,闪电网络的本质是在比特币主网之外又构建了一个点对点(p2p)网络。闪电网络单笔交易几乎不用手续费,因为不需要共识机制来记账。

  在两个节点间创建并开通一个支付通道的过程实际上是在比特币主网上广播了一个需要多重签名的交易,并锁定了两个账户预存在支付通道中的比特币金额。

  闪电网络最终会把比特币主链变成一个结算链,既账户在经过一段时间的交易后在主链上仅记录当前的余额状况(用一笔结算交易表示,该交易会关闭当前的支付通道)。

  闪电网络的惩罚机制是靠多重签名来实现的,不是依靠某种外部的机制。也就是说预存在支付通道中的双方的金额受双方的签名共同控制,任何一个人想赖账,他的这部分资金都无法取回。这个多重签名的交易就是要锁定双方预存的资金的,这笔资金就不能再用来做其他的转账交易了”。

  有人会将闪电网络里的支付通道与区块链的侧链混淆,实际上二者是有本质区别的。

  闪电网络里的支付通道实际上是在两个节点之间建立了另外一个网络路径,这个支付通道是网络层面上的概念,跟链无关,这个支付通道上进行的频繁的小额交易完全依靠别的方式进行记录和计算,不会保存在一个链上,更不会保存在主链上。

  而侧链是新建了一条区块链,但是这个区块链跟绑定的主链之间是双向锚定,也就是有一套数据的转移技术(协议)来负责链上的数据的转换,这个侧链可以由一些新加入的节点构成一个网络来维护(参与这个侧链的共识),也可以直接由主链的网络节点来参与共识并维护。所以说侧链和闪电网络中的支付通道完全不是一个层次上的概念。

  闪电网络也面临很多问题:

       1.有被攻击成功的可能性;

       2.交易失败率较高;

       3.矿工收入减少可能会对比特币主网维护产生不利影响;

       原文链接:https://www.kg.com/article/494806999343697920

你可能感兴趣的:(闪电网络是什么?)